Abstract :
Business processes perform a significant role in increasing the success of organizational processes and functionalities. Due to the ever increasing growth in the scale and complexity of processes in line with taking advantage of combinational methods and ideas to optimize workflows and gain higher efficiency, lack of a framework considering both business process semantic and structure for business process modeling is completely sensible. Adding semantic to business process models will result in more comprehensible and automatically-executable processes. Moreover, preparing a suitable structure by making use of software architectural concepts will lead to a major decrease in misunderstanding of complexities. In this paper, a style-based semantic framework is represented which improves business processes and their models, and enhances management of them in a semantically and structured way, by this approach business processes will become measurable with respect to different criteria.
